Monitor Interactions on Live cells in Real time

LigandTracer monitors molecular interactions in real-time, right on your lab bench, with only a few preparatory steps and limited input.

It is a flexible platform compatible with a large number of applications. We have chosen to divide them based on what insights you aim for or the type of immobilized (target) or labeled (ligand) interaction partners you have. Almost all applications can be done with all instrument models.

LigandTracer Models

LigandTracer_Instruments_Web_Hi_009 copy 3

Green – Detects Fluorescence

LigandTracer_Instruments_Web_Hi_012
Yellow – Detects high energy ɣ including annihilation photons
LigandTracer_Instruments_Web_Hi_011 copy
Grey – Detects low energy photons (ɣ and X-rays) and high energy particles (Beta+/-)
LigandTracer_Instruments_Web_Hi_010 copy 2
White – Detects Beta+/- particles

Characterize the interaction
with Tracedrawer

TraceDrawer is a powerful and versatile evaluation tool for real-time binding data. With a few button-clicks it provides the rate constants of the interaction, its affinity and information about target saturation. Multiple tools and models are available for a more thorough analysis of e.g. the binding mechanism.
